Golden brown triangles, stuffed with a spicy concoction of potatoes and green chilies, popularly known as samosas, are perfect for a cold winter evening.
HT City brings you a list of 5 places where you may have some delectable samosas.
Delite Cinema,Asaf Ali RoadThe samosas here are humongous and probably the largest in the city. Priced at Rs 30 a piece, these samosas are a meal in itself. So even if you are not planning to catch a movie here, do go upstairs and try out their potato stuffed samosas. It’s neither too spicy, nor too bland. Just perfect.
Samosa wallas, in front of the Scindia House, CP
The lanes in front of Scindia House are lined up with three samosa wallas. They sell small cocktail samosas. Priced at Rs 5 for four samosas, these finger licking delicacies are a favourite with the office goers . More than anything it is the tiny size and live cooking that make them a hot seller.
Frontier Samosa, Panchkuian roadThis is one of the oldest shops in the city, set around 1947. The shabby little eatery serves some of the most delectable triangles. They are priced at Rs 6 a piece. The samosas here are served with spicy and oily chhola. Gobhi, paneer and dry fruits samosas are also served here.
Bengali Sweet House, Bengali MarketThe samosas here are mirchi-laden, hot and are served with chhola and green chillies on demand.
Manohar’s Japani Samosa, Lajpat Rai MarketThey say it’s a samosa but it’s not triangular like the regular ones. The samosas here are layered like patties with fillings of potatoes and peas. These are served with a liberal dose of chhola.
